I think its 11t pinion, +/- 13degs of collective, not sure on the cyclic. Head settings are on the lowest flybar mixer ratio/max swash input and max flybar twist with the stock paddles on the front hole.
the biggest change has been the blades which are SAB red devils. It transformed the model, lightening fast cyclics and collective compared to the maniacs that were on there. It needed a bit more expo on it tho which is why it was a little higher than it normally is :-) Ade

The advanced settings recommendation isnt the fastest possible settings on the head, any reason why you wouldn't want all the fastest settings on the head ?

because the fastest settings introduce a lot of variables to the head changing flybar input and delta angle. Whilst they may be faster they may not be the best feel or give the most predictable flight characteristics.
